If youre in a business and youre connecting multiple sites together or you need to connect your organization to the internet, youre probably leasing a line from a third party to be able to provide this connectivity. And in this video, well look at many different ways for providing some of this leased line connections. A type of leased line thats been around for a very long time is the T1 and the E1. T1 stands for T-Carrier Level 1. It uses time-domain multiplexing to send traffic from one site to the other. And you commonly see T1s in North America, Japan, and South Korea. A T1 has 24 channels. And each channel can transmit 64 kilobits per second. And you put all of that together, and you have a total amount of bandwidth on a T1 of 1.544 megabits per second as a total line rate. If youre elsewhere in the world, for instance in Europe, you have the E1. E1s have 32 channels, again 64 kilobits per second, giving you a total of 2.048 megabits as a total line rate over an E1.
